Output dc51360b5717a1806603ad9f43ff5e7f4c3a3a522e27b954e361e3dfb85b2660:89

value
108403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05fcf6b541671285164f8a81d17d2cea4ad63e97 OP_EQUAL
address
32EgLjF5Qc8F7HWD6UZ2xAdYjszGm8i4rk
transaction
dc51360b5717a1806603ad9f43ff5e7f4c3a3a522e27b954e361e3dfb85b2660
spent
true